Many employers ban ChatGPT, Copilot, or Claude, or set up proxies around them. The arguments are valid: privacy, security, and the EU AI Act. No one wants customer data or source code to end up in a free chatbot with big tech in the USA. The concerns are justified.
And yet, it doesn't work.
After all, a ban does not stop the use. It only makes it invisible. My proposition: an AI ban says more about the organization than about the employee.
That shadow AI percentage says nothing in itself. High is no cause for alarm, low is no reassurance. It is about the combination, the dynamic between the employer's policy and the employee's behavior.
Just think about it: if the organization facilitates safe and usable AI, and employees are aware of that offering, the logical reason to switch to personal subscriptions disappears. The percentage drops. Not due to bans, but simply because the alternative is better.
At the same time, it holds true that if employees do not feel a need for AI in their work, no shadow usage will occur. Not because of control, but because of a lack of motivation.
A low percentage can therefore go two ways. It could be because the organization has arranged things properly, or because the workforce is asleep at the wheel.
If you plot policy and behavior against each other, four recognizable situations emerge. I call this the Shadow AI Matrix.
On the horizontal axis: employer's AI policy (absent or restrictive versus present and appropriate). On the vertical axis: shadow AI usage by employees (low versus high). Four quadrants.

The Shadow AI Matrix shows two things at the same time.
The top row (Uncontrolled Growth and Mismatch) shows immediate risk. High levels of shadow AI mean that customer data, source code, and strategic information end up somewhere you have no visibility into. Compliance, security, and privacy are under pressure.
The right column (Mismatch and Balance) shows growth potential. Policy and infrastructure are the foundation upon which AI can scale, gain experience, and develop.
Mismatch has both: risk and building blocks for growth. It can be improved if the organization dares to bridge the gap between policy and practice. Balance has only growth, no risk; that is what you want to achieve.
And then there is Stagnation.
A low shadow AI percentage might seem reassuring. But Stagnation is actually the highest risk quadrant.
No policy, no experience, no learning effect. Competitors are building a lead that will be difficult to catch up with later. Talent wanting to work with AI is seeking an environment elsewhere. And when external pressure arises—legislation, customers, the market—the organization will be left without building blocks.
Anyone who reads the shadow AI figure without taking those two axes into account is reading it incorrectly.
When I mention AI policy, it is not just about which tools you facilitate or which proxies you set up. It is also about what you do with the people who work with those tools.
Since February 2025, the EU AI Act requires demonstrable AI literacy (Article 4). Employees must understand what AI does and does not do, what dangers are associated with it, and how to deal with it. This is not tool training. It is the ability to critically assess what AI delivers, what you can entrust to AI, and when AI is deceiving you.
The most significant effect lies at the heart of the shadow AI issue. An employee who is unaware that a free chatbot might reuse their input for training, or that outputs without verification lead to reputational damage, does not see why they are prohibited from uploading customer data or source code. A formal prohibition then remains a rule lacking understanding, and rules lacking understanding are ignored in the shadows. An employee who <em>does</em> understand the dangers is more likely to choose the responsible route themselves, even without IT monitoring.
AI literacy is therefore the silent foundation beneath the Shadow AI Matrix. It makes the difference between policy that looks good on paper and policy that works in the workplace. An organization that wants to direct rather than prohibit cannot do without it.

My plea: go for directing. Not because it sounds fashionable. But because the other three options assume control over AI usage. Directing is about giving direction to what is already happening. It acknowledges that employees will always win, and converts that energy into something that moves the organization forward.
